688776 2008-07-14 08:56:00 Got this old Lenovo laptop with no Model Number! When the Power button is pressed, no POST but a series of 'short' beeps; I have to press and hold the power button to turn it OFF. Sometimes, the following error messages appears on the screen:

Booting GM Edition Default Menu

kernel (h00) /boot/gmb/memdisk.gz

error 16: File not found

press any key to continue


When I press any key, nothing happens, but keep on beeping.

Any cure?

688779 2008-07-14 09:17:00 It has got a stick of RAM. The keyboard seems to be not responding, so I plug in an external usb kb and managed to get into the BIOS setup without any beeps. Changed to boot from CD and inserted an XP boot disk but half-way through while coping files, it started to beep again and everything halted.

Maybe I shouldn't spend any more time with this junk.:badpc:
